Output 484436672dd7ab52470bc148f074019731e4f13addf6f9a173ba1a11d8dfc99f:3

value
370489722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d845a1ccffd26fef3974337e6803943f6a5996d5 OP_EQUAL
address
3MQZJ6csA3wB7VVuFKDijyAGU8L9ZXm1XK
transaction
484436672dd7ab52470bc148f074019731e4f13addf6f9a173ba1a11d8dfc99f
spent
true